Footage Of 6ix9ine’s Alleged Kidnapping Hits The Internet

Watch a video which supposedly shows the moment Nine Trey Blood members captured Tekashi.

(AllHipHop News) Over the last two days, Daniel “Tekashi 6ix9ine” Hernandez testified in federal court about a wide range of topics allegedly connected to the Nine Trey Bloods gang in New York City. Hernandez has been called the “star witness” for the prosecution’s case against Anthony “Harv” Ellison and Aljermiah “Nuke” Mack. 

“As alleged in the Superseding Indictment, Aljermiah Mack, like his Nine Trey co-conspirators, engaged in brazen acts of gun violence and narcotics dealing. Thanks to our remarkable partners at HSI, ATF, and the NYPD, he now faces federal charges for his serious crimes,” stated U.S. Attorney Geoffrey S. Berman.

Ellison and Mack are on trial for conspiracy, robbery, and firearm charges. They are also accused of kidnapping and robbing 6ix9ine in 2018. The defendants’ legal team claimed the incident was actually set-up by the “Fefe” rapper to promote his music career.

Footage of the alleged incident has made its way to YouTube. In the video, the person credited as Tekashi can be heard saying, “I’ll give you everything. I promise you, Harv.”

In another section of the clip, 6ix9ine seems to admit to being scared and mentions the word extortion. Ellison allegedly forced 6ix9ine into another vehicle before someone identified as “Sha” assaulted him.

According to reports, Tekashi described the kidnapping in court on Wednesday. He is quoted saying, “We came to an agreement. If I gave them the jewelry they would let me go.”

Hernandez testified that the kidnappers drove him back to his Bedford-Stuyvesant home, and Sha went inside to retrieve the jewelry. However, instead of letting him go, the Brooklyn native said they drove him around for a few more blocks before he escaped and was able to jump into the backseat of a random car stopped nearby.
